The sacerdotal ordination of Deacon Elvost Lunchi, pic, on July 22 was a momentous occasion filled with joy and colour. It marked a significant historical milestone as it was the second ordination of a Malaysian Mill Hill missionary and the first in Sabah.
Fr Bernie Luna MHM, the Councillor for Asia, represented the General Council and encouraged the Church in Sabah to support their missionaries, especially through prayers. Although the Mill Hill Missionaries do not serve in Sabah anymore, Elvost’s ordination brings a ray of hope and is a manifestation of the maturity of the Sabah Church, which is now ready to send missionaries to foreign lands.
